The High School Student Experience: Absence and Overcoming Challenges

One significant aspect of high school life is managing absences, whether due to illness, family matters, or other personal reasons. Absence from school, especially during critical academic periods, can be a source of anxiety for students. Catching up on missed work and staying on top of assignments can be a daunting task, but it is also an opportunity to develop strong self-discipline and responsibility.

When a student misses school, they face the challenge of regaining lost time and maintaining their academic standing. However, many high schools now provide resources to help students who are absent, including online access to class materials, tutor services, and the opportunity to attend extra study sessions. These resources are designed to ensure that students can make up for lost time without feeling left behind.

Beyond academics, absence can also mean missing out on social experiences. Events like dances, sports games, and class trips are often highlights of high school life, and missing these can contribute to feelings of isolation. However, it’s important to remember that life in high school is about more than just these events. Each student’s journey is unique, and catching up academically and emotionally after an absence can be a great way to grow personally.

Student Tip: Stay organized and communicate with your teachers about any missed work. It’s also helpful to stay connected with friends so you don’t miss out on important social experiences. You might even find ways to make up for missed events through different activities or by participating in future ones.
